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Atif's Salamander | Black Duiker |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Amphibia (Amphibians)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Caudata (Caudata) |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) |
| Family | Salamandridae | Bovidae (Bovids) |
| Genus | Lyciasalamandra | Cephalophus |
| Species | Lyciasalamandra atifi | Cephalophus niger |
Evolutionary Relationship
Atif's Salamander and Black Duiker share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
